🗹 1. Organized Cabling and Wiring

Although it may not be the most fun feature to consider, structured wiring is the backbone of your conference room system. 

All wiring should be hidden within the walls or beneath tables, connecting video, audio, content sharing, and lighting to a centralized control system. This attention to detail is crucial for creating a polished, professional environment.

If your office is under construction, have your integrator install hidden wiring before the walls are closed over. 

🗹 2. High-Quality Video Displays

In today’s hybrid era, you’ll need high-quality video displays to share both video conferencing feeds and content being reviewed. 

Depending on your needs, you might choose a single large screen, dual side-by-side displays, or interactive touchscreens for presentations and brainstorming sessions. Ensure your display is bright, clear, and easy to view from all seating positions, even in rooms with natural light. Dealing with glare? Motorized shades can help with that. 

For larger spaces or highly visual presentations, LED video walls are an excellent option that ensures everyone in the room can see content in crisp detail.

🗹 3. Integrated Audio Solutions

Speakers should be strategically placed to provide balanced sound throughout your meeting room. In-ceiling or in-wall speakers help maintain a clean, professional aesthetic, with wiring concealed for safety and elegance. 

Paired with tabletop or ceiling microphones, these systems ensure that all voices are clearly heard during hybrid meetings or virtual calls.

🗹 4. Wireless Content Sharing

Gone are the days of fumbling with cords and adapters to share a presentation. A wireless content-sharing solution allows employees and guests to project their screens onto the main display with a few taps over Wi-Fi, streamlining meetings and saving time.

🗹 5. Convenient Tabletop Controllers

Simplify the room’s operation with a tabletop touch controller that connects to all devices and systems in the room. With one intuitive interface, you can adjust lighting, volume, displays, and even initiate video calls—all from the table.

🗹 6. Thoughtful Table and Chair Arrangement

Your seating arrangement should reflect how your room will be used. For frequent video conferencing, a crescent-shaped table oriented toward the displays ensures everyone is visible to the camera.

If your table is long and rectangular, consider installing multiple auto-tracking cameras that can switch to the speaker as they talk.

🗹 7. Advanced Lighting and Shade Control

Lighting sets the tone for every meeting. Integrate motorized shades to block glare during video calls and smart lighting systems to adjust the ambiance. Wall-mounted touch panels or custom keypads with pre-set options like “Presentation” or “Afternoon Meeting” allow you to change settings instantly.

🗹 8. User-Friendly Wall Control Panels

A touchscreen or keypad installed near the entrance can control the entire room—AV, lighting, shades, and even climate settings. Custom-engraved buttons make operation simple for all staff, ensuring meetings start on time without technical hiccups.
